Is it still possible to install Windows 10 for free in 2026? Yes. While Microsoft officially ended standard support in October 2025, the Media Creation Tool remains active, and digital licenses from previous Windows versions (7, 8, and 11) still allow for a legal, $0 installation.

In this guide, I will walk you through the safest method to get Windows 10 running on your machine today, including how to handle activation without spending a dime.

Windows 10 System Requirements for 2026 (Still Supported?)

Before starting your free Windows 10 installation, ensure your hardware meets these minimum requirements to avoid setup loops or “Blue Screen” errors.

  1. Processor: 1 GHz or faster compatible processor.
  2. RAM: 2GB for 64-bit (though 8GB is recommended for 2026 standards).
  3. Storage: At least 32GB of free space.
  4. Internet: Required for updates and initial setup.

Pro-Tip: If you are using an older machine with an HDD, consider upgrading to an SSD. Even a cheap SATA SSD will make Windows 10 feel 3x faster.

Never download Windows from third-party “mirror” sites. These often contain pre-installed malware or “cracks” that compromise your data.

  1. Visit the official Microsoft Software Download page.
  2. Under “Create Windows 10 installation media,” click Download Tool Now.
  3. Run the Media Creation Tool (it’s a small, portable .exe file).
  4. Select “Create installation media (USB flash drive, DVD, or ISO file) for another PC” and click Next.

Create a Bootable USB for Free

You will need a USB drive with at least 8GB of space. Warning: Everything on this drive will be deleted.

  1. Option A (Easiest): Select “USB flash drive” directly within the Microsoft Media Creation Tool. It will format the drive and download the files automatically.
  2. Option B (Power User): Download the ISO file and use Rufus to flash it. This is helpful if you need to bypass specific partition requirements (MBR vs. GPT).

How to Install Windows 10 from USB (Step-by-Step)

Now that your media is ready, follow these steps to perform a “Clean Install.”

1. Boot from USB: Restart your PC and tap the BIOS key (usually F2, F12, or DEL). Set your USB drive as the primary boot device.

2. Start Setup: When the Windows logo appears, select your language and keyboard layout. Click Install Now.

3. The “Free” Secret: When asked for a product key, click “I don’t have a product key” at the bottom. Windows will allow you to finish the installation for free.

4. Custom Install: Choose “Custom: Install Windows only (advanced).” Delete all existing partitions on your primary drive until it shows as “Unallocated Space,” then click Next.

Once installed, your PC will be “Unactivated,” meaning you’ll have a watermark and limited personalization settings. Here are the legal ways to activate it:

1. The Digital Link: If your PC previously had Windows 10 or 11, simply sign in to your Microsoft Account. The “Digital License” tied to your hardware will activate it automatically.

2. The Old Key Trick: Surprisingly, many Windows 7 and Windows 8.1 product keys still work to activate Windows 10. Enter your old sticker key in Settings > Update & Security > Activation.

3. Hardware-Bound Licenses: If you bought a refurbished PC, the license is likely embedded in the BIOS. It should activate the moment you connect to the internet.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Is Windows 10 safe to use in 2026?

This is a critical concern. Since free security patches ended in October 2025, Windows 10 is more vulnerable to new threats. If you must use it, we recommend using a robust third-party antivirus and avoiding sensitive tasks like online banking. For better security, check if your PC can upgrade to Windows 11 for free.

If you don’t activate Windows 10, the OS remains functional, but with two main drawbacks:

  • Watermark: A persistent “Activate Windows” message will appear in the bottom right corner.
  • Personalization: You cannot change your wallpaper, accent colors, or lock screen settings. However, security updates (if available) and software compatibility remain the same as the activated version.

The safest way is to download it directly from the Microsoft Software Download page. Avoid third-party “cracked” sites, as these ISOs often contain malware or backdoors that can compromise your data.
